Executive Vice President and Provost

Dr. Donald J. Leo serves as the Ohio University Executive Vice President and Provost. He is a professor of mechanical engineering and most recently served as the first dean of the College of Engineering at the University of Georgia. At Ohio University Dr. Leo manages the academic deans and a variety of offices that foster academic quality and student success.

Accreditation at Ohio University

Ohio University is accredited by the Higher Learning Commission. While over 30 of the University鈥檚 academic programs are accredited by their own disciplinary accreditors, Ohio University as a whole is accredited by HLC; all of the University鈥檚 programs and units are covered by this institution-wide accreditation. HLC offers two different pathways to institutional accreditation. They are the Standard Pathway and the Open Pathway. Ohio University has been on the Open Pathway since 2019. The next HLC Comprehensive Evaluation and visit will occur during the 2034-35 academic year.
